- catalog description "System requirements for accompanying CD-ROMs: Intel Pentium or compatible CPU. (some Intel 486 computers may work, but it's hit-or-miss) : at least 32MB RAM althrough 64MB or more is recommended, to run the GNOME or KDE desktop, Red HAt reommends at least 64MB. : Atl least 500 MB of hard disk space (you have to select minimal install. You need 1.5 GB of hard disk space for a typical workstation installation or at least 1GB of space for a server installation. To install everything you need about 4.6GB of space : A CD-ROM drive. this is recommended for installation, although you can install over a network or from a local hard disk instead. for those types of installs, you need at least a 3.5 inch floppy disk drive and either an extra hard disk partition or another computer (that can be reached over the network) that has packages or images of Red Hat Linux CDs on it. (I tell you how to do that later, in case you're interested.".
